The house lies to the North. You can make out a small (250lt) green water butt to the left of the house and solar tubes that heat our water on the roof.
To the East you can see a large pile of wood waiting to be chopped and split - the bounty of the severe winter storms we had that year. Behind this is the original stone cottage that was built on this site in the mid 19th century.
To the South is the orchard and polytunnel.
The new soon-to-be-filled woodshed is to the West.
